A Catechism on the Sacrament of Holy Confirmation
What is the Sacrament of Holy Confirmation? Did Our Lord institute it? The Sacrament of Confirmation is the Sacrament of Christian maturity, the Sacrament which properly completes Baptism, making us full members of Christ’s Church. It conveys to the baptised Christian the Seal of the Holy Ghost, the fulness of the Holy Spirit in His…
